CVE-2024-20462
Last modified
CVE-2024-20462 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 5.5/10 on the CVSS scale. A vulnerability in the web-based management interface of Cisco ATA 190 Series Multiplatform Analog Telephone Adapter firmware could allow an authenticated, local attacker with low privileges to view passwords on an affected device. This vulnerability is due to incorrect sanitization of HTML content from an affected device.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to view passwords that belong to other users.. EPSS estimates a 0.16%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Cisco | Ata 191 Firmware | < 12.0.2 |
| Cisco | Ata 191 Firmware | < 11.2.5 |
| Cisco | Ata 192 Firmware | < 11.2.5 |
